Output e230996159411833a193f865cb8f2e23ca396dd01e6d5431640073546f511c68:25

value
149118
script pubkey
OP_0 OP_PUSHBYTES_20 86ea5fd3c32aeda17c40d5a921aebc79a540c34d
address
bc1qsm49l57r9tk6zlzq6k5jrt4u0xj5ps6dlr3vdq
transaction
e230996159411833a193f865cb8f2e23ca396dd01e6d5431640073546f511c68